Definition and Types of Claim Expenses

Claim expenses in the insurance industry encompass a wide range of costs incurred during the claim settlement process. These expenses can vary widely and include administrative fees, legal costs, medical assessments, and even advertising expenses related to specific claims.

Elvtr categorizes claim expenses into two main types: internal and external expenses. Internal expenses refer to the costs incurred within the company, such as employee salaries and overhead costs, while external expenses are those paid to third parties, like legal consultants or medical experts.

Tax Treatment of Different Expense Types

The tax treatment of claim expenses varies depending on the type of expense and the jurisdiction. Elvtr's experts offer specialized advice, considering factors such as the nature of the claim, the insurance policy terms, and the applicable tax laws.

For example, in certain jurisdictions, legal fees associated with insurance claims may be deductible, while in others, they might be subject to specific limitations or exclusions. Elvtr's tax team stays abreast of these variations, providing tailored guidance to ensure compliance.
